Summary

Goal: Align CartSnitch's public GitHub presence with our core mission: helping individual shoppers save money at grocery stores.

Changes

  • Headline: Changed from vague 'vigilant shopping companion' to benefit-driven 'Save money on every grocery trip'
  • Messaging: Shifted from tech-centric to shopper-centric language
  • Value prop: Added specific savings number ($50+/month) to build trust
  • Navigation: Fixed broken Documentation/Contributing links → real product URLs
  • Audience: Split messaging to address both shoppers and developers

Before/After

Before: 'Tool for monitoring shopping carts, price changes, and availability' (tech-focused, vague)
After: 'Finds deals you'd miss. Never overpay for groceries again.' (benefit-first, clear)

Why

  • Shoppers land on this page and need to understand value immediately
  • Current tech stack section alienates consumer audience
  • Broken links hurt credibility
  • Messaging should speak to busy parents, not engineers
